On average across the year,
no, Missouri, United States is not hotter than
Bellflower, California
.
Missouri, United States has an average temperature of 14°C/57°F and Bellflower, California has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F.
Missouri, United States's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is hotter than Bellflower, California's hottest month (August,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).
On average across the year, yes, Missouri, United States is colder than Bellflower, California . Missouri, United States has an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F and Bellflower, California has an average minimum temperature of 14°C/57°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Missouri, United States has more rain than
Bellflower, California. Missouri, United States has an average annual rainfall of 1122mm and Bellflower, California has an average annual rainfall of 268mm.
Missouri, United States's wettest month is May, with an average monthly rainfall of 142mm, which is wetter than Bellflower, California's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 67mm).
